About L.M. Rode
L.M. Rode is a scholar working on Agronomy and Crop Science, Genetics, Plant Science, Animal Science and Zoology and Ecology, Evolution, Behavior and Systematics, having authored 100 papers that have together received 5.8k indexed citations. Recurring topics across this work include Ruminant Nutrition and Digestive Physiology (84 papers), Reproductive Physiology in Livestock (30 papers), Genetic and phenotypic traits in livestock (29 papers), Animal Nutrition and Physiology (11 papers), Phytase and its Applications (10 papers), Turfgrass Adaptation and Management (10 papers), Plant and fungal interactions (7 papers) and Microbial Metabolites in Food Biotechnology (5 papers). The work is most often cited by research in Agronomy and Crop Science (4.9k citations), Animal Science and Zoology (1.1k citations), Forestry (254 citations), Genetics (1.7k citations) and Nutrition and Dietetics (873 citations). L.M. Rode has collaborated with scholars based in Canada, United States and France. Frequent co-authors include K. A. Beauchemin, Wenzhu Yang, Tim A. McAllister, Wen Yang, K. M. Koenig, Diego Morgavi, K.-J. Cheng, Weijuan Yang, C. J. Newbold and M. Ivan. Their work appears in journals such as Journal of Dairy Science, Canadian Journal of Animal Science, Journal of Animal Science, Animal Feed Science and Technology and British Journal Of Nutrition.
